Html Css Анимация Движения Картинки Stack Overflow На Русском

Micron — это библиотека микровзаимодействий, управляемая JavaScript, созданная с помощью CSS-анимаций. Проще говоря, micron позволяет вам легко прикреплять несколько анимаций к элементам при щелчке по ним. Существуют также другие параметры настройки, которые помогут вам регулировать поток анимации.

Оригинальные hover-эффекты на CSS3 применяемые для эффектного появления подписей миниатюр изображений при наведении. В набор правил CSS входят 10 различных эффектов, которые вы можете использовать отдельно для https://deveducation.com/ разных картинок. Эффекты по-настоящему впечатляют, особенно понимая то, что всё это сделано лишь с помощью CSS3. Удивительно, как простые вещи могут оживить обычную веб-страницу, сделать ее более доступной для восприятия пользователями.

анимация картинки css

Д., и позволяет прикреплять их к пользовательским элементам, пока пользователи прокручивают их. Главное при создании сложных эффектов – правильно управлять временем и синхронизацией анимаций. В CSS для этого используется свойство animation, которое позволяет применять несколько анимаций к одному элементу. В CSS управление продолжительностью анимация картинки css и задержкой анимации осуществляется через свойства animation-duration и animation-delay. Эти свойства позволяют точно контролировать, как долго будет длиться анимация и когда она начнёт выполняться.

По умолчанию это значение равно 1, что означает, что когда анимация достигнет конца временной шкалы, она остановится в конце. Свойство animation-duration определяет, насколько длинной должна быть временная шкала @keyframes. Анимация будет продолжаться, но будет слишком быстрой для восприятия. Идентификатор используется в различных местах CSS и позволяет задать собственное имя для объектов. Эти идентификаторы чувствительны к регистру, и в некоторых случаях есть слова, которые нельзя использовать. Например, при именовании строк в CSS Grid нельзя использовать слово span.

Обновление CSS3 позволяет создавать анимации и условно отображать их для различных псевдосостояний. Для применения более сложных анимаций можно комбинировать несколько ключевых кадров или использовать @keyframes для различных свойств одновременно. Для создания анимаций изображений с помощью CSS можно использовать директиву @keyframes. Она позволяет задать последовательность изменений на протяжении определенного времени, создавая эффект плавного перехода между состояниями изображения.

Долгое время разработчики были ограничены Flash-плеерами и GIF-файлами, когда им требовалось отобразить анимацию на веб-странице. Используйте префиксы для старых браузеров, например, -webkit- для Safari и Chrome, -moz- для Firefox, -ms- для Web Explorer. Это позволит элементу увеличиваться и уменьшаться с плавным переходом.

анимация картинки css

Чтобы понять, как работает анимация, загляните в исходный код демо-страницы, отдельной документации не обнаружил. CSS-анимация – это мощный инструмент для создания привлекательного и динамичного UI на сайте. Она позволяет дизайнерам воплощать в жизнь динамичный дизайн и делать веб-сайты более интерактивными и визуально привлекательными. В то время как базовые CSS-анимации относительно просты в создании, продвинутые анимации требуют больше навыков. В этой статье мы рассмотрим некоторые продвинутые методы анимации CSS и приведем примеры кода, которые помогут вам начать работу.

Это позволяет управлять анимацией, останавливая её в нужный момент или возобновляя выполнение. Это особенно полезно при использовании JavaScript, чтобы останавливать или запускать анимацию динамически, например по событию нажатия кнопки или наведению мыши. В наших веб-проектах мы часто используем CSS-анимации — они позволяют без JavaScript придавать элементам страницы интерактивность. Сегодня разберём, по какому принципу работают анимации в CSS, какие есть основные свойства и где брать интересные элементы для своих проектов.

  • Более того, в некоторых из них вы даже сможете научиться как создавать что-то подобное самому.
  • Эффекты по-настоящему впечатляют, особенно понимая то, что всё это сделано лишь с помощью CSS3.
  • Не все пользователи любят или могут воспринимать активные анимации.
  • Для создания ключевых кадров используется директива @keyframes.

Css Animations

анимация картинки css

Для управления поведением таких анимаций можно задать хронометражную функцию, длительность, количество повторов и другие атрибуты. Изображение по сути four hundred х 400px, но мы уменьшим его под наш блок 300 х 300px (Строка №3 и №4).Изображение изменяется плавно к исходному изображению 400 х 400px (Строка №14 и №15). За плавное изменение размеров отвечает свойство transition, где указанно 1 секунда. Набор красивых эффектов при наведении на миниатюры, различные виды появления и оформления подписей к картинкам. Тонкие линии в контрасте с слегка затемнённым фоном создают лёгкие для восприятия информационные блоки.

Оптимизация Производительности Анимаций На Сайте

Обратите внимание на то, как две планеты взаимодействуют друг с другом, а также на умелое расположение частиц, которые воссоздают эффект беспорядочности. Мобильные браузеры с каждым днём становятся всё лучше и лучше, предоставляя нам возможность наслаждаться потрясающими анимациями. Пользователи могут указать в своей операционной системе, что при работе с приложениями и веб-сайтами они предпочитают уменьшать количество движений.

Hover-эффекты Для Миниатюр На Css3

Первая часть, на которую следует обратить внимание, — это custom ident (пользовательский идентификатор), или, говоря более человеческим языком, название правила ключевых кадров. Это, как вы узнали из модуля Функции, позволяет ссылаться на правило ключевых кадров в других местах вашего CSS-кода. Во втором примере установлены три значения для каждого из свойств. После того, как вы настроили временные свойства (продолжительность, ускорение) анимации, вы должны определить внешний вид анимации.

Теперь браузер знает, что ключевые кадры анимации с названием circle-to-square должны применяться к элементу с классом child-one. После ключевого слова @keyframes мы должны написать имя анимации. Оно понадобится нам, чтобы связать анимацию для конкретного элемента с ключевыми кадрами. Начать создание нашей анимации нужно с разложения её на шаги — ключевые кадры. Наша анимация будет простая, у неё будет FrontEnd разработчик всего два ключевых кадра.

Leave a Comment

Your email address will not be published. Required fields are marked *

error: Content is protected !!
Open chat
1
Hello
How may we help you?